This course will provide a detailed overview of the Medicare Secondary Payer act as well as provide an update for changes and anticipated changes for 2023. The course will be beneficial to both plaintiff and defense attorneys.
Learning Objectives:
• Review of the PAID act after the first year
• Civil Money Penalties in Section 111 reporting
